![]() ![]() The solutions are 40 grams of copper acetate in one liter of water or 13 grams each of copper chloride, copper nitrate, muriatic acid and ammonium chloride in 1 liter of water. That special treatment may be applying different solutions on surface. So, it is difficult to apply paint on it without any special action. In general, Galvanized iron surface does not contain adhesive nature with paint. Oxy acetylene flame is used to burn off the paint surface and then it is scrapped with brushes. Repainting of steel and iron surfaces is as same as new surfaces but cleaning of old paint is most important. Repainting of Old Steel and Iron Surfaces After drying up, smooth finishing coat of desired paint is applied. This should be applied using brush.Īfter that, two or more under coats are applied which consist 3 kg of red lead in 5 liters of boiled linseed oil. Now prime coat is applied which consists 3kg of red lead in 1 liter of boiled linseed oil. stains on surface can be washed with benzene or lime water.īefore applying prime coat, the surface should be treated with phosphoric acid to get better adhesive nature. If there is any rust or scales, should be wiped off using steel brushes etc. Before painting the surface must be cleaned. Painting of iron and steel surfaces will resist the rust formation due to weathering. Before that the surface is rubbed with pumice stone or glass paper and then 2 to 3 coats of paints are applied.
